Video: Webinar: Hvordan kan lærere gjøre nettinnhold universelt utformet? 2024
Når du har avgjort om en besøkende på nettstedet ditt bruker en iPhone eller en iPad, kan du skjule innhold fra en enhet når du leverer hver side. I kontakten. php-siden som brukes i dette eksemplet, kan du se at vi leverer annen informasjon til iPhone med PHP-koden i toppteksten:
1Anropsmerke eller 2 e-postmerke
3 4Anropsmerke på +1 (234) 567-8901 eller 5 Email Mark
6 7
Den første linjen viser en if-setning; det kontrollerer for å se om variabelen $ iPhone er sant. (= Operatøren brukes til å tilordne en verdi; == Evaluerer om to elementer er like, og === avgjør om to elementer er like.)
Hvis $ iPhone er sant, tilbyr en H3-seksjon på siden to Alternativer brukeren kan opptre på: Ring mark, som starter en telefonsamtale på iPhone eller E-postmerke, som lager en e-postmelding.
Hvis den besøkende på denne siden ikke bruker en iPhone, blir telefonsammenkoblingen fjernet, og kun e-postalternativet tilbys. På den måten viser en iPad eller en nettleser ikke et klikk for å ringe som mislykkes på en enhet uten telefon. Vi beholder e-postalternativet for alle som har en Internett-tilkobling.
Vi viser en type innhold og ikke en annen ved å bruke en if / else-setning. Dens format ligner if-setningen, men legger til slutt ellers klausulen, som erstatter innholdet i den første blokken - i dette eksemplet, Anropsmerke eller E-postmerke, med et enkelt alternativ, E-postmerke, i den andre blokken hvis enheten er ikke en iPhone.
Merk: Dette eksemplet er fokusert på iPhone og iPad; For å målrette mot andre enheter spesielt, må du kanskje legge til ekstra kode.